Move-in ready 3BR/2BA single-story block home in South Tampa with a backyard rebuilt from the ground up by its landscape architect owner. Built in 1953, 1,500 sqft. /// 2019 roof, 2020 air conditioning, 2020 water heater, block construction, and a full 2020 appliance package covering refrigerator, range, dishwasher, microwave, washer, and dryer. New plank flooring is an eco-friendly, PVC-free alternative to vinyl. Everything here happens on one level, and the open floorplan means you're never cut off from the room you just left. Open and central kitchen with a bar that seats three that overlooks the dining room. From here, two bedrooms sit at the front of the house. One has a Murphy bed, so it hosts guests without giving up the floor space the rest of the year; the other is set up as a home office right now and converts back just as easily. The owner's suite takes up the back of the home, and it's where the house departs from its 1953 footprint- a former bedroom has been converted into a fabulous custom dressing room with built-in vanity. The conversion is reversible, which puts the fourth bedroom back. The laundry room is also at the back, with a door out to the garden patio. That yard is the part you'll remember. A landscape architect owned this house and treated the outdoor space like a project, revamping and replanting it so there's something worth looking at in every season. A large storage shed handles the overflow, and the long driveway gives you room to park. You're minutes from Dale Mabry and Gandy Boulevard, which puts the Gandy Bridge, St. Petersburg, and downtown Tampa all within easy reach!
